Eight is an English equivalent of 'octa-'. The syllables represent a root and a prefix in the classical Latin of the ancient Romans. Both come from the earlier, classical Greek of the ancient Greeks.
The classical Latin and Greek languages are the sources of 'octa-'. The syllables represent a Greek and Latin prefix that's borrowed by the English language. Use of the prefix gives the meaning of 'eight' to a word.

The classical Latin and Greek languages are the sources of the prefixes 'octa-', 'hexa-', and 'penta-'. The prefixes respectively mean 'eight', 'six', and 'five'. They come into English by way of the Latin of the ancient Romans and by way of the even earlier Greek of the ancient Greeks.
